Fairing Kits

I hit a deer a few months back and had liability insurance on the bike. I finally saved up enough to rebuild my '06 ZX-6R, but now I don't know who's a good manufacturer to buy from. I need a lot more than just the fairings(speed-o, headlight, brackets, etc.), but it's a good place to start. Do you guys recommend anyone specific? I can't afford OEM parts.

They all work, I had eBay fairings on my 954 and fit OK. But if u drop it there going to crack a lot worse the OEM.

im ordering mine from auctmarts. they have decent pricing and lotsss of color schemes. i was ripped off on ebay just months ago. buy cheap u get cheap. they didnt come close to fitting!!! i spent 200 on return shipping then the dick didnt wanna refund me. try to get the fairings from someplace located in your home continent.lol
auctmarts is outta cali i beleive.
